What is an associate technician?
Career: Associate Technician
Associate Technicians are entry- to mid-level professionals who provide technical support and assistance in a variety of industries, such as IT, engineering, manufacturing, or healthcare. Their responsibilities typically include installing, maintaining, troubleshooting, and repairing equipment or systems under the supervision of senior technicians or engineers. They may also assist with data collection, documentation, and quality control tasks. Associate Technicians often work as part of a team and are essential for ensuring the smooth operation of technical processes and systems.
